Mel Tillis To Be Honored on January 31st

The life of Mel Tillis will be honored in celebration of life’ event at the Ryman Auditorium on January 31st at 10am. Scheduled to appear at this wonderful ceremony are the Gatlins, Ricky Skaggs, Alison Krauss, Ray Stevens, and members of the Tillis’ Stateside band. Mel died this past November in Ocala Florida at the age of 85. Mel Tillis was born in Tampa, Florida, and lived the life of […]

Alabama Takes Home Another Championship

The college football national championship was decided last night and what a game it was. The Alabama Crimson Tide came back down from 13-0 to force overtime and win 26-23. This one did not lack drama though as Alabama missed two short field goals, one as time expired and another in the first half. Did we mention that Alabama benched their starting quarterback going into the second half and that […]
